Unified Agenda of Federal Regulatory and Deregulatory Actions-Fall 2023
The FCC's Fall 2023 Unified Agenda indicates upcoming rulemakings on TCPA issues including one-to-one consent, revocation of consent, and autodialer definition. No immediate action required, but businesses should monitor for proposed rules.
